The Advantages of Choosing Vinyl
Vinyl flooring offers several benefits that make it an attractive choice for many homeowners. Its water-resistant nature makes it suitable for kitchens and bathrooms where moisture could be an issue with other types of flooring. Additionally, vinyl provides a comfortable surface to walk on, adding a layer of insulation underfoot.
- Durability ensures longevity even in high-traffic areas.
- Easy maintenance with simple cleaning routines.
- Cost-effective compared to hardwood or stone.
- Wide variety of design choices to fit any aesthetic.

Installation and Maintenance Tips
When installing vinyl sheet flooring, it’s important to ensure the subfloor is clean and level to prevent imperfections from showing through. Regular sweeping and occasional mopping are usually enough to keep your floors looking pristine. Avoid using abrasive cleaners that could damage the surface over time.
